
You are invited to have a Yarn at The Farm and celebrate NAIDOC Week in the Hills Shire.
The day will be filled with FREE cultural experiences, hands-on workshops, traditional arts and crafts, market stalls, live music, sport, and First Nations-inspired cuisine.
Look forward to:
- FREE cultural workshops & traditional arts and crafts activities
- FREE sporting activities with AFL NSW, Parramatta Eels, and Western Sydney Wanderers
- Live music, storytelling, traditional dances, performances, and market stalls
- FREE servings of Indigenous fusion cuisine from Wilka Thalta food truck (500 servings)
We’ve partnered with Muru Mittigar to bring about this fantastic event, which honours the oldest continuing culture on earth.
This National NAIDOC Week activity is funded by the National Indigenous Australians Agency.
See on July 10, 10am-2pm at Bella Vista Farm.
